Natural Pest Traps to use in an Organic Garden

Dan May 18, 2021 Organic, Pest/Pest Control, This Land of Ours

Some natural pest traps to use in an organic garden. That’s coming up on This Land of Ours. There are some homemade pest traps that will help you get rid of pesky ants, flies, gnats, and other insects without having to worry about chemicals harming your plants.   • The State of Lemon Production in Argentina
    Argentina’s lemon production for 2025–26 is projected to remain steady at 1.9 million metric tons (MMT) by the U.S. Department of Agriculture Foreign Agricultural Service (USDA FAS).
